OnePlus 16 Rumors and Specs Shuffle
In the ever buzzing world of smartphones, the OnePlus 16 is teased as a Q4 2026 release, but official confirmation remains scarce. The chatter centers on potential specs and design ideas that might shape the next flagship, yet nothing concrete has been officially announced by OnePlus yet. The tale is woven from leaks and speculative whispers rather than confirmed facts, so readers should regard it with caution and patience.
Sleek Display Talks and Refresh Rates
Early chatter suggested a display capable of extraordinary refresh rates, with some mentions of up to 240Hz. Newer leaks contort that notion, proposing a more modest 185Hz refresh rate as the probable reality. The discrepancy illustrates how rumors can diverge, leaving potential buyers unsure whether the screen will feel blisteringly fast or merely brisk in everyday use, depending on the final tuning by OnePlus.
Camera and Design Highlights
A new leak hints at very narrow display bezels and a 200MP periscope telephoto camera offering 3X optical zoom. This aligns with a growing trend toward higher megapixel cameras in premium devices, though the practical benefits and image quality in day-to-day shots will depend on sensor performance, processing, and software optimization. There may also be a dedicated AI button, reminiscent of features rumored for the OnePlus 15, though exact implementation remains unconfirmed at this juncture.
Resolution on the Main Sensor and Processor Talk
Industry chatter from tipsters suggests that the OnePlus 16 could carry a 50MP main sensor, contrasting with some other next-gen flagships that push toward 200MP on the primary camera. Separately, there are whispers about a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 6 Pro chipset powering the phone, paired with a battery around 9,000mAh. As always with leaks, these claims should be treated with skepticism until official specs surface from OnePlus themselves.
